28/**
29 * VorbisComment metadata conversion mapping.
30 * from Ogg Vorbis I format specification: comment field and header specification
31 * http://xiph.org/vorbis/doc/v-comment.html
32 */
33const AVMetadataConv ff_vorbiscomment_metadata_conv[] = {
34    { "ALBUMARTIST", "album_artist"},
35    { "TRACKNUMBER", "track"  },
36    { "DISCNUMBER",  "disc"   },
37    { 0 }
38};
39
40int ff_vorbiscomment_length(AVDictionary *m, const char *vendor_string,
41                            unsigned *count)
42{
43    int len = 8;
44    len += strlen(vendor_string);
45    *count = 0;
46    if (m) {
47        AVDictionaryEntry *tag = NULL;
48        while ((tag = av_dict_get(m, "", tag, AV_DICT_IGNORE_SUFFIX))) {
49            len += 4 +strlen(tag->key) + 1 + strlen(tag->value);
50            (*count)++;
51        }
52    }
53    return len;
54}
55
56int ff_vorbiscomment_write(uint8_t **p, AVDictionary **m,
57                           const char *vendor_string, const unsigned count)
58{
59    bytestream_put_le32(p, strlen(vendor_string));
60    bytestream_put_buffer(p, vendor_string, strlen(vendor_string));
61    if (*m) {
62        AVDictionaryEntry *tag = NULL;
63        bytestream_put_le32(p, count);
64        while ((tag = av_dict_get(*m, "", tag, AV_DICT_IGNORE_SUFFIX))) {
65            unsigned int len1 = strlen(tag->key);
66            unsigned int len2 = strlen(tag->value);
67            bytestream_put_le32(p, len1+1+len2);
68            bytestream_put_buffer(p, tag->key, len1);
69            bytestream_put_byte(p, '=');
70            bytestream_put_buffer(p, tag->value, len2);
71        }
72    } else
73        bytestream_put_le32(p, 0);
74    return 0;
75}
